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75935593634 7111 28188071192 9358700905 32786993
097703718 58293702
097703718 58293702
0895628 955 5212141
All about undefined
Interested in learning more?
097703718 58293702
0895628 955 5212141
See more
637273 491257627 660
751023919 5822456 6421662 327675
See more
1944519 5051 77570
85850038 026967818 62866 688
See more